KeyToss, a free, powerful, and personalizable site designed for smartphones, has updated their mobile portal to include a several new features, including customized links, Gmail status, and mobile transcoders. The KeyToss mobile portal works on both Palm OS and Windows Mobile, as well as other popular smartphone operating systems such as BlackBerry and Symbian.

Verizon Treo 700wx 1.24 Update
As rumored several months ago, Palm has released an updater for the Verizon Treo 700wx that brings its software to version 1.24 and up-to-date with Windows Mobile 6 Professional.
Windows Mobile 6 provides a number of improvements, such as improved calendar functionality, enhanced HTML email support, Office 2007 support, Windows Vista compatibility, improved security, email hot keys and search, and access to documents stored on SharePoint servers. Read on for more details.

#*#377#. Ever wondered if there was more to this than just showing the system error log? That’s the Verizon variant of the error log code, which is one of the many (and often times mysterious) hash codes that give you access to hidden features on your Palm device.
Please note: The function of some of these codes still remain a mystery to enthusiasts. A lot of them were discovered through trial and error (yes, we have a lot of time on our hands), and while the presence of some of these codes can be easily discovered this way, their purposes are often more difficult to understand. We have indicated some codes with which users should be particularly careful. Also, these codes have only been tested on Palm OS devices, so we cannot confirm nor deny their usability on Windows Mobile devices.

Sprint Treo 800w Update
Palm have released a cabinet file update for the Treo 800w that is “highly recommended for all Treo 800w devices”.
This update address two main areas - a USB device detection problem, and a problem with charging completely discharged batteries.
